The price of a typical alfalfa bale varies considerably based mostly on a number of components, together with geographic location, time of yr, provide and demand, and bale measurement and sort. Typical bale sizes embody two-string, three-string, and huge sq. bales, every with totally different weights and related prices. For instance, a three-string bale may weigh between 100 and 120 kilos, whereas a big sq. bale may weigh upwards of 1,000 kilos. The prevailing market value is usually quoted per ton, making it essential to issue within the weight of the bale when calculating the overall value.
